第三週作業

2022-06-04 14:51:14 字數 2319 閱讀 4553

這個作業屬於哪個課程

這個作業要求在**

homework/11451

這個作業的目標

提公升撰寫博文能力與編碼能力

學號20209205

pta 實驗作業
1. 求分數序列前n項和實驗**截圖

資料處理:1:資料表達:int i n 整型,double fenzi,分母,sum 雙精度浮點型。

2:for迴圈(int i=1;i<=n;i++)

pta提交列表及說明

a:在for迴圈的結構中找清計算的原理,用數學語言準確描述公式。

2:求簡單交錯序列前n項和

實驗**截圖

資料處理:1:int n,count,flag整形,double sum 雙精度浮點型。

2:for迴圈中將flag= - flag在一次迴圈後,flag自動變為相反數,保證資料輸出的準確性。

pta提交列表及說明

a:在運用公式表示的時候,數學語言可以用不同的方法表示,在乙個迴圈到下乙個迴圈要注意公式的實用性。

3:for迴圈練習:1到x的累加和,並按指定格式輸出

實驗**截圖

資料處理:1:int n 整型,double sum,i 雙精度浮點 。

2:for 迴圈結構,pta提交列表及說明

a:在輸出1+...+4=10時,所用的表達方式是printf("1+...+%d=%d\n",x,sum);

閱讀**(-5—5分)

題目:求兩式之和

**截圖

優點:**簡單易懂,運用當今所學的for迴圈結構容易理解,在運用for迴圈的同時,使用if語句,確保輸出資料的正確性,定義整形,基礎的編碼語句但又可以更好結合我們當前所學的內容以及知識,如for(j=i+1;j學習總結(15分)

3.1:學習進度條(5分)

周/日期

這週所花時間

**行數

學到的知識點簡介

目前比較迷惑的問題

第三週3天

100for迴圈結構,定義整形與浮點型

不同輸出格式該用相對應的數學語言表示

3.2 累積**行和部落格字數(5分)

時間部落格數

**行數

第一周420

16第二週

65086

第三週/

3.3:學習感悟 (5分)

在這週的學習當中,不管是pta和作業其實都讓我寸步難行,一開始看見這題目是一臉懵逼的,由於沒有做過這類的作業,比較生,但經過許多次的嘗試與修修改改,以及提問,我也終於完成了這門作業,但對我來說,我收穫最大的卻是學會了怎樣去解決乙個問題,改如何解決,問題所在在哪,這對於我以後的學習生涯是一件很有幫助的事情。編寫**其實不容易,在程式設計的過程中,我們需要想如何將要表達的用**的形式給寫出來,讓計算機懂,要用什麼方式去編寫,改怎麼編寫,這都是我們需要做的。最開始的學習是寸步難行,但一步一步乙個腳印,學無止境,什麼都是從最簡單最基礎的學起,在有問題的時候這才開始磨鍊我們的思考能力,與解決問題的能力,這是乙個過程,沒有問題何來解決,何來進步,沒有什麼永遠是暢通無阻的,就算是程式設計,對於計算機的編碼出錯的問題有很多,解決問題也變成我們進步的方式。雖然程式設計不容易,但我覺得,沒有什麼**是寫不出來的,沒有什麼程式是造不出來的,世上無難事只怕有心人嘛,這一周的學習讓我十分深刻,學到了很多,不僅僅是在程式設計方面。很期待以後的學習,因為學習能讓我提公升自己,磨鍊自己的能力,將自己變得更有價值。

第三週作業

實驗作業 1.輸入課本各個例題,除錯執行程式,並分析程式,將每乙個程式改寫2到3個版本,自己分析程式結果,然後再除錯執行,核對分析結果的對錯。2.編寫程式輸入乙個三角形的三條邊,計算其面積和周長 3.編寫程式計算並輸出課本本章習題3表示式的值並分析結果。4.編寫乙個程式,輸入乙個一元二次方程的三個係...

第三週作業

要求 1.輸入課本各個例題,除錯執行程式,並分析程式,將每乙個程式改寫2到3個版本,自己分析程式結果,然後再除錯執行,核對分析結果的對錯。2.編寫程式輸入乙個三角形的三條邊,計算其面積和周長 3.編寫程式計算並輸出課本本章習題3表示式的值並分析結果。4.編寫乙個程式,輸入乙個一元二次方程的三個係數,...

第三週作業

第一題 輸入課本各個例題,除錯執行程式,並分析程式。例1 include using namespace std int main 例8 includeusing namespace std int main else cout this is not a endl return 0 第三題 編寫程...